Jason Romero

Executive Vice President at QTS

Jason Romero has a diverse work experience in the construction and real estate industries. Jason started their career as a Construction Supervisor at Romero Construction Inc. in 2002 and worked there until 2007. Jason then worked as a Construction Consultant at CCL Construction Consultants, Inc. from 2008 to 2009. Subsequently, Jason worked as a Construction Attorney at Husch Blackwell from 2009 to 2010.

In 2010, Jason joined Stinson Leonard Street LLP as a Real Estate Attorney, where they provided legal services for various real estate and construction projects. Jason worked there until 2014 when they transitioned to Husch Blackwell as a Real Estate Partner. In this role, they served as an attorney on the Real Estate, Development, and Construction industry team and co-chaired the Investment Real Estate industry sector group.

In 2018, Jason joined Platform Ventures as a Vice President. In this role, they worked on all aspects of the business, including acquisitions, dispositions, leasing, financing, tax incentives, project development, asset management, and strategic planning for investments in real estate assets, operating companies, and technologies throughout the United States. Platform Ventures is a registered investment advisor with approximately $2.7 billion in assets under management.

Most recently, in 2022, Jason became the Executive Vice President at QTS Data Centers, where they currently hold a leadership position.

Jason Romero began their education in 2002 at The University of Kansas, where they earned a Bachelor of General Studies (B.G.S.) degree in American Studies in 2006. In 2005, Jason participated in a Semester Abroad program at the University of Melbourne. Following this, they pursued a Master of Science (M.S.) degree in Construction Management at the University of Kansas - School of Engineering from 2006 to 2009. At the same time, they also attended the University of Kansas School of Law and obtained a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ree specializing in Law. Continuing their education, Jason completed a Master of Business Administration (MBA) degree with a focus on Finance and Strategic Management from The University of Kansas School of Business between 2010 and 2013. Recently, in 2021 and 2022, Jason obtained a Professional Leadership Certificate from The University of Kansas.
